When I first got the M90 and bought my first set of slicks, I bought 28" rears. At that power level (around 400hp) and the 3.73 gears it was not a pretty sight. I could either go through the traps in 3rd bouncing off redline or I could shift into 4th about 200' before the finish line. I got rid of that setup after 2 weeks. That was over 2 years ago and I'm finally getting to the power level where I might be able to pull a 28" tire with the 3.73 gears.
Unfortunately there is also the issue of the very tall 1st gear in the T56 so going with a taller tire will hurt me more on the starting line.
